Maddy summaryHouse Joint Resolution 1284 is a commemorative measure that honors Marina Mason, a high school softball player from Brentwood, Tennessee. The resolution recognizes her achievement of being named the 2025 WILLCO Awards Softball Player of the Year for her outstanding performance, including leading her team with 339 strikeouts. This legislative action serves to publicly acknowledge her success as an athlete and her positive impact on her school and community.
Maddy summaryThis Tennessee House Joint Resolution honors Tristiano Alfano, a Franklin High School soccer player, for being named the 2025 WILLCO Awards Boys' Soccer Player of the Year. The bill recognizes his athletic achievements, including scoring sixteen goals and making six assists, as well as his role in advancing his team to the state tournament. It serves as a formal commendation from the state legislature to highlight his success and character as a student athlete. The resolution is ceremonial and does not create any new laws or policy changes.
